Storyline
Plot Summary |
A drama that follows the travails of the Pineda family in the Filipino city of Angeles. Bigamy, unwanted pregnancy, possible incest and bothersome skin irritations are all part of their daily challenges, but the real "star" of the show is an enormous, dilapidated movie theater that doubles as family business and living space. At one time a prestige establishment, the theater now runs porn double bills and serves as a meeting ground for hustlers of every conceivable persuasion. The film captures the sordid, fetid atmosphere, interweaving various family subplots with the comings and goings of customers, thieves and even a runaway goat while enveloping the viewer in a maelstrom of sound, noise and continuous motion. Trivia | Director Brillante Mendoza revealed that the sex scene between Coco Martin and Mercedes Cabral was simulated. "It was assumed by everyone that in the sex scene there was real penetration. The actors knew how I work, and if they were on a different level of their profession, they probably would have had real sex. But since this was the girl's first film and she's from a conservative family, she had done enough, so there is no penetration. But I wanted people to believe there was actual sexual intercourse, and it was so realistic that people believe that's what happened," he explained. See more » |
